How to Replace Bifold Doors
A lot of home improvement stores sell bifold doors as kits which include the door panels and installation track. The door should be approximately one inch smaller than the frame opening.
If your bifold closet doors sag open, it could be due to a loose top guide pin for the sliding track or the bottom rotating floor pin might be out of place or even missing. These issues can be simple and cheap to fix.

If you're thinking of adding bifold doors to your home, it's important to understand the procedure for installation. Accurate measurements are the most important factor to success. Inaccurate measurements can lead to a lot of frustration and wasted funds. Measure the opening (also called an "aperture") in different locations, including at the top middle and bottom. This will allow you to determine the maximum width of your bifold doors.
Ideally, your bifold door should be slightly smaller than the opening into the frame in which it will be placed. This will ensure the proper clearance and the mechanisms used to attach doors to frames. It is also essential to measure the opening without any trim. Trims can add millimetres, which could impact the fit of your new bifold door.

Installing bifold doors can be an excellent method to open up a space and create a larger feel. But, if your bifold doors aren't properly installed they may not open or close smoothly. This is due to the fact that they could have been damaged or misaligned during the installation process.
A damaged or misaligned hinges or handles could cause issues with your bifold doors too. These issues can cause bifold doors to catch on the floor, or to not open and close fully. These problems are usually simple to fix.
Verify the track for looseness or damage in the event of problems with your bifold door. It's an excellent idea to ensure that the track guide is in place and hasn't moved from its position. You can adjust the position of the track guide by loosening screws with the help of a screwdriver.

The most important aspect to think about when purchasing new bifold doors is the material. Bifold doors are available in a variety of materials like aluminium and uPVC. Both materials have advantages and disadvantages. For example, aluminium is more expensive than uPVC however it has a longer life span and has a higher durability. On the other the other hand, uPVC is cheaper but it is not as durable as aluminium, and can be easily damaged by harsh weather conditions.

After the installation is complete After the installation is complete, you must check the door to see if it opens and shuts smoothly. If the door isn't closing smoothly, you might need to tighten the screw inside the jamb brackets. You may also loosen the track bracket and move it. Alternately, you could try to adjust the track by closing the doors, and then pushing or pulling on them to find a spot where they meet perfectly.
